一、WordPress與MySQL數據庫之間是什么關系
說的簡單點,wordpress或者類似的網站程序就類似一輛BUS,而數據庫僅僅是一個記錄系統。這兩BUS長的是什么樣子的是由類似WP的程序決定的,但是這輛BUS的內容比如坐了多少人,每個人特征,坐在什么位置等等都記錄在數據庫里。
數據庫僅僅是一條條的記錄,比如某個乘客的特征是屬于數據庫的,但是這個乘客本身并不是數據庫,比如制作網站會用到很多圖片文件,這些圖片文件保存于網站空間,數據庫頂多記錄這個圖片用在什么位置,具體怎么呈現,但是文件本身并不包含在數據庫,所以如果把這張圖片刪除,雖然數據庫有這條圖片的記錄,但是在某個位置會直接顯示個XX。
WordPress 是一個應用層系統,用來組織內容。開發者選擇把這些內容存放在 MySQL 中來維護,這樣他們可以不去關心數據以何種具體形式來存儲維護,只需定義抽象的數據模式,并通過標準接口 (SQL) 來操作數據。實現了這個標準接口的數據庫系統有很多,MySQL 只是其中之一。存儲的數據簡單來說是每個 WordPress 用戶或是每篇日志都不同的內容,比如博客標題、用戶名字、文章內容、評論內容、后臺選項等。要知道這些數據的組織結構,還是要用 MySQL 客戶端去看數據庫的表結構。
延伸閱讀:
二、Navicat是什么
Navicat是一套快速、可靠和全面的數據庫管理工具,專門用于簡化數據庫管理和降低管理成本。Navicat圖形界面直觀,提供簡便的管理方法,設計和操作MySQL、MariaDB、SQL Server、Oracle、PostgreSQL和SQLite的數據。
Navicat提供一個直觀和設計完善的用戶界面,用于創建、修改和管理資料庫的所有對象,例如表、視圖、函數或過程、索引、觸發器和序列。我們的表設計器幫助用戶創建和修改數據庫的表,讓設置高級選項,如關系、限制、觸發器和更多。
使用Navicat瀏覽和修改數據,插入、編輯、刪除數據或復制和粘貼記錄到數據表形式的數據編輯器,Navicat將運行相應的命令(例如INSERT或UPDATE),免除寫復雜的SQL。廣泛的數據編輯工具令編輯工作更為方便,例如外鍵查找、set/enum選擇器和記錄篩選。